饥饿对分枝杆菌影响的研究。

Studies on the effect of starvation on mycobacteria.

作者信息

Nyka W

出版信息

Infect Immun. 1974 May;9(5):843-50. doi: 10.1128/iai.9.5.843-850.1974.

DOI:10.1128/iai.9.5.843-850.1974
PMID:4132910
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C414896/
Abstract

Ten cultures of Mycobacterium tuberculosis, one of Mycobacterium kansasii (nonsignificant), and one of Mycobacterium phlei were submitted to starvation. As a result they lost first their acid fastness and then all other staining affinities but, in this chromophobic state, they survived for at least 2 years and, after that time, produced cultures of acid-fast bacilli when transferred onto nutrient media. Chromophobic tubercle bacilli similar to those produced experimentally had previously been demonstrated in caseous lesions of lungs surgically removed from patients under chemotherapy. Since it has been shown that experimentally produced chromophobic bacilli can recover their original biological properties, the opinion is warranted that, under suitable conditions, those in the lung could also become reactivated and cause a relapse of the disease.

摘要

十株结核分枝杆菌培养物、一株堪萨斯分枝杆菌(无显著意义)培养物和一株草分枝杆菌培养物被置于饥饿状态。结果,它们首先失去抗酸性,然后失去所有其他染色亲和力,但在这种拒色状态下,它们存活了至少两年,之后转移到营养培养基上时产生了抗酸杆菌培养物。与实验产生的类似的拒色结核杆菌此前已在接受化疗的患者手术切除的肺部干酪样病变中得到证实。由于已经表明实验产生的拒色杆菌可以恢复其原始生物学特性,因此有理由认为,在合适的条件下,肺部的那些拒色杆菌也可能重新激活并导致疾病复发。
